State of Anarchy: Master of Mayhem Review | Pixel Opinions

Ever wanted to revisit the classic, top-down action of the original Grand Theft Auto titles or Smash TV? State of Anarchy: Master of Mayhem is an arcade-inspired shoot-’em-up where the objective is to rob banks, kill aliens, and then rob more banks and kill even more aliens until the credits finally roll.

State of Anarchy: Master of Mayhem (PS4) Review | GamePitt

Rob Pitt writes: We’ve seen lots of different top-down shooters this generation, some good, some bad. The common mechanic/genre which a lot of developers love to mix with their top-down shmups is the bullet-hell genre – where you’ll spend most of your time ducking in and out of the bullets than actually concentrating on where you’re going or what you’re shooting at!

State of Anarchy: Master of Mayhem dials it back a little and delivers an original looking game which isn’t as intense as a lot of games out there, but also delivers a nice challenge which will last you a good few hours in order to platinum.
